Senior Advocate of Nigeria, Bode Olanipekun, informed the court that his objection stemmed from the failure to formally serve the charges to Otudeko and his two co-defendants.

The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C) has filed a 13-count charge against Otudeko, former First Bank Plc. Managing Director Olabisi Onasanya, and former Honeywell board member Soji Akintayo.

Olanipekun is representing all three defendants, as well as Anchorage Leisure Ltd., a company also named in the case.

The EFCC alleges that the defendants fraudulently obtained the funds.
